SHDA’s 34th National Developers Convention to chart next steps for Philippine housing
Abi Sarabia M., Philippine Canadian Inquirer
August 30, 2026

Photo courtesy: Subdivision and Housing Developers Association – SHDA
TAGUIG, Philippines — Housing developers, government policymakers, financial institutions and other industry stakeholders will come together for the 34th National Developers Convention on September 16 and 17, 2026, at Marquis Events Place in Bonifacio Global City, Taguig.
Organized by the Subdivision and Housing Developers Association (SHDA), the two-day convention will provide a platform for discussions on the policies, market changes and emerging solutions shaping housing and community development in the Philippines.
This year’s gathering carries the theme, “Elevate: Sustaining Progress through Collaboration and Strategic Housing Innovations.” It aims to encourage stronger cooperation across the housing value chain as the industry responds to evolving buyer preferences, regulatory changes and demand for more affordable, sustainable and inclusive communities.
Sessions will cover housing policy and regulatory developments, financing, household and homebuyer trends, strategic housing innovations and sustainability. Participants will also have opportunities to exchange insights, establish partnerships and explore practical approaches to addressing the country’s housing needs.
The convention comes as residential demand expands beyond Metro Manila, supported by infrastructure development and growing interest in suburban and emerging urban centers. First-time buyers and young families continue to influence demand, particularly in the economic and affordable housing segments.
At the same time, developers must keep pace with policy adjustments and shifting market conditions to ensure that projects remain accessible, responsive and viable.
Now in its 34th year, the National Developers Convention is one of the country’s key gatherings for the housing and real estate development sector. It brings together stakeholders whose decisions and partnerships help shape the future of Philippine communities.
